## Nightly Reindex — Quick Notes

Hey — welcome to reviewing the Pindle search stack. The nightly reindex job runs from a locked-down runner and pushes a signed manifest before swapping indexes. Nothing goes live unless the manifest verifies. Secrets live in the vault, rotated quarterly. For your audit, the manifest is signed with the key shown below.

rollout seal: bky4_DFM9

## Ticket: Config drift on pricing experiment hosts

The Fairgate ticket-pricing experiment is serving inconsistent prices because two of the four Stubline app hosts are running stale experiment parameters. Drift was introduced during last week's hotfix, which was applied by hand on only half the fleet. On-call: until the config management run is fixed, treat any price-mismatch alert as drift, not a pricing bug. Re-sync the stragglers and restart the experiment workers. The canonical values every host should carry are:

deployment values, yadug-bawif:
[framir]
team = pelox
access_code = ac_a38ab2
owner = tamion.julael
host = framir.tolvaqlabs.test
port = 11211
peer = tammir.zemvargrid.local
salt = 2215ef03
pin = 1541

Branch managers: this briefing summarizes the half-year performance review for Quennel Foods across the Arvale, Sotherby, and Limric districts. Arvale exceeded plan by 9%, driven by the Fieldline product refresh; Sotherby lagged at 84% of quota, largely due to delayed distributor onboarding. Limric held steady. Ines Maddow will present corrective actions, including revised territory splits, at the review. Please verify your branch figures beforehand. The confidential planning note from the executive committee follows below.

internal memo for yahap-badug: Headcount on the Zorys team goes from 28 to 129 by the end of March. Gross margin on Zorys came in at 40 percent against a plan of 48 percent.

**CI note: profile-store sharding failures**

If the shard-migration job in Brindlewood CI fails on step 4, it's almost always the fixture data: the user-profile seed assumes 8 shards, but the test matrix now runs 16. Regenerate fixtures with the reseed script before retrying. Don't bump the shard count in config directly — the router caches the ring and you'll get split-brain reads. Ask Maren before touching the migration runner. Failures reproduce locally only on the build listed here:

session token of tajef-bageg = htk21_5d90d574934f3ccae6437